Output e593931d633a7b5db69bd699dc461de8bfd6a467e0866ea6dad9ec1b69111743:0

value
62771843
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a3c12d37bf26a244347e118e1a7f7b429064afa OP_EQUAL
address
MEfgCcEhfe36yuL9sDkYZvM8o52CMMq3i2
transaction
e593931d633a7b5db69bd699dc461de8bfd6a467e0866ea6dad9ec1b69111743
spent
true